Specifications include, but are not limited to: Tasks include but are not limited to, the following: • Provide all necessary materials, equipment, and incidentals required to perform citywide regular traffic signal maintenance, safety light maintenance and on-call traffic signal repairs. • Provide and maintain emergency service response to the City’s traffic signals and safety streetlights, on a twenty-four (24) hour a day, seven (7) days per week basis, including all holidays. Must provide emergency contact information. • Provide vehicle(s) with company logo and with permanently mounted arrow boards; warning beacon/strobe lights; traffic cones; construction warning sign; a hydraulic bucket capable of reaching a height of at least thirty-five feet (35’) from the roadway surface; necessary computer laptop for programming, maintenance, and testing of traffic signal controllers and various equipment; and communications for dispatch. • Possess all required tools and equipment needed to perform all work necessary to maintain and repair the traffic signals and safety lights in the City in compliance with current City standards and specification. • Provide a monthly inspection report for all signalized locations. • Provide a quarterly nighttime inspection report of all signalized intersection safety. • Include any additional services that are not listed
